if PN=29cm and MN=13 , then PM=?

*see attachment for the figure referred to
Answer/Step-by-step explanation:
1. PN = 29
MN = 13
PM = ?
[tex] PN = PM + MN [/tex] (Segment addition postulate)
[tex] PN - MN = PM [/tex] (subtract MN from each side)
[tex] 29 - 13 = PM [/tex] (substitute)
[tex] 16 = PM [/tex]
[tex] PM = 16 cm [/tex]
